This is where the concept of “relationship bases” comes in. Relationship bases are a way of measuring how physically intimate two people in a relationship are. The four bases are: first base, second base, third base, and a home run. The first base is kissing, the second base is touching or feeling each other up, the third base is oral sex, and the home run is sexual intercourse.
So, are relationship bases real? It isn’t very easy. While there may be some truth to the idea of physical intimacy being connected to certain base levels, it’s not quite as simple as that.
The reality is that relationships are unique and individual, so it’s important to communicate with your partner about what you both feel comfortable doing physically. Ultimately, it’s up to you and your partner to decide what level of intimacy you want to explore.
